— Recall Campaign #14V557000
Volvo Trucks North America (Volvo) is recalling certain model year 2015 VNL and VNX trucks manufactured January 7, 2014, to June 5, 2014, and equipped with a D16 engine. Due to the engine control unit having an incorrect parameter setting in the software, the engine may stall.
The recall was influenced by the manufacturer with about 46 units affected.

- Consequeces:
- An engine stall while driving increases the risk of a crash.
- Corrective action:
- Volvo will notify owners, and dealers will update the engine control unit software, free of charge. The recall began in October 2014. Owners may contact Volvo customer service at 1-800-528-6586. Volvo's number for this recall is RVXX1404.
